Qullat Mawjan
Qullat Mawjan is a hamlet in Ghamr, Saada Governorate and has about 124 residents and an elevation of 1,641 metres. Qullat Mawjan is situated nearby to the hamlet Qullat Ja`ar, as well as near Shatt `Ajwan.| Tap on a place to explore it |
